在st_2中建立student_2表,并按照student表设置学号、姓名、性别、年龄及所在系。其中,姓名属性应不为空值,性别属性取值范围为男或女。
时间: 2024-02-24 17:56:13 浏览: 33
可以使用以下SQL语句在st_2数据库中创建student_2表:
```
CREATE TABLE student_2 (
sno CHAR(10) PRIMARY KEY,
name VARCHAR(20) NOT NULL,
gender ENUM('男', '女') NOT NULL,
age INT,
department VARCHAR(20)
);
```
其中,sno为学号,name为姓名,gender为性别,age为年龄,department为所在系。sno被设置为主键,保证了每个学生的学号唯一性。name被设置为NOT NULL,保证了每个学生的姓名不为空。gender被设置为ENUM('男', '女'),限制了其取值范围为男或女。age和department可以为空。
相关问题
利用SQL在st_2中建立student_2表,并按照student表设置学号、姓名、性别、年龄及所在系。其中,姓名属性应不为空值,性别属性取值范围为男或女。
可以使用如下的SQL语句在st_2数据库中创建student_2表:
```
CREATE TABLE student_2 (
id INT PRIMARY KEY,
name VARCHAR(50) NOT NULL,
gender ENUM('男', '女') NOT NULL,
age INT,
department VARCHAR(50)
);
```
这个语句创建了一个名为student_2的表,其中包括id、name、gender、age和department五个属性。其中id是主键,name不能为空,gender必须是男或女,其他属性可以为空。你可以根据实际情况修改属性的名称和类型。
在st_2中建立SC_2表,并按照SC设置学号、课程号及成绩。成绩限制在0~100分之间;Sno参照student_2表sno,并进行删除级联设置和更新级联设置;cno参照Course_2表cno,并进行更新级联设置和拒绝删除设置。
好的,你的问题是在st_2中建立SC_2表,并按照SC设置学号、课程号及成绩。成绩限制在0~100分之间;Sno参照student_2表sno,并进行删除级联设置和更新级联设置;cno参照Course_2表cno,并进行更新级联设置和拒绝删除设置。
为了实现这个要求,我们可以使用以下的SQL语句:
```
CREATE TABLE SC_2 (
Sno CHAR(10) NOT NULL,
Cno CHAR(10) NOT NULL,
Score INT NOT NULL CHECK (Score >= 0 AND Score <= 100),
PRIMARY KEY (Sno, Cno),
FOREIGN KEY (Sno) REFERENCES student_2 (Sno) ON DELETE CASCADE ON UPDATE CASCADE,
FOREIGN KEY (Cno) REFERENCES Course_2 (Cno) ON DELETE RESTRICT ON UPDATE CASCADE
);
```
这个SQL语句创建了一个SC_2表,包含了Sno、Cno和Score三个字段。其中,Sno和Cno是主键,并且Sno参照了student_2表的Sno字段,采用了删除级联设置和更新级联设置;Cno参照了Course_2表的Cno字段,采用了更新级联设置和拒绝删除设置。同时,Score字段采用了CHECK约束,限制了成绩在0~100分之间。
希望能够帮助到你,如果你还有其他问题,请继续提问。
相关推荐
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)